CVE-2025-69516
Amidaware Tactical RMM SSTI Vulnerability
Description
A Server-Side Template Injection (SSTI) vulnerability in the /reporting/templates/preview/ endpoint of Amidaware Tactical RMM, affecting versions equal to or earlier than v1.3.1, allows low-privileged users with Report Viewer or Report Manager permissions to achieve remote command execution on the server. This occurs due to improper sanitization of the template_md parameter, enabling direct injection of Jinja2 templates. This occurs due to misuse of the generate_html() function, the user-controlled value is inserted into `env.from_string`, a function that processes Jinja2 templates arbitrarily, making an SSTI possible.

Solution
- Update Amidaware Tactical RMM to the latest version.
- Sanitize all user-supplied template inputs.
- Restrict access to sensitive template functions.
- Review template rendering logic for security.
